There are about 3000 species of earthworm, in the Subclass Oligochaeta of the Phylum Annelida. Genera include Lumbricusand Eisenia.
Full binomial name examples include Lumbricus terrestrisand Eisenia fetida.

The two levels of classification used in scientific naming are genus and species. This system is known as binomial nomenclature, with organisms being identified by their genus and species names.
